How to evaluate quickly

  1. Open three candidate pages. For each, read the Plans & Pricing block and the Key features list. Skip the marketing — focus on usage limits (credits, tokens, minutes).
  2. Use side-by-side compare. Every tool page auto-generates a “Website & App Buildersalternatives” comparison so you don’t have to open three tabs.
  3. Watch a demo before signing up. Many tools embed a 90-second walkthrough — it’s the fastest way to spot whether the UX matches your workflow.
  4. Start on the free tier when possible. If a tool only offers a trial (no real free tier), assume you’ll be billed in 14 days unless you cancel — set a calendar reminder.
